Web25 Aug 2024 · Post-tension tendons are stressed using a hydraulic ram, which is connected to a gauge. That gauge is calibrated by the jack supplier (usually the post-tension material supplier) so that the operator knows exactly what pressure corresponds to 33.0 kips (80% of the minimum ultimate tensile strength of the tendon).
